Overview

A remote contractor role focused on shaping AI performance through real-world input. You’ll review and create examples for model outputs, collaborate with a distributed team, and provide clear written rationales to support learning objectives. Your domain knowledge in a specialized field drives the quality of prompts, tasks, and data annotations that guide AI reasoning. This project relies on precise feedback, adaptable methods, and thorough documentation of progress.

Who Should Apply

The ideal candidate brings strong domain expertise and a track record in precise written and verbal communication. They can work independently on remote projects and adapt quickly to evolving guidelines. This role may be less suitable for someone without substantive subject knowledge in a specialized field or without experience in data annotation, teaching, research, or technical writing. Common rejection reasons include limited domain depth or struggles to deliver detailed, well-justified feedback and to adhere to project guidelines.
